  • What steps are involved in the hoarding cleanup process?

    The hoarding cleanup process typically follows a structured approach to ensure efficiency and emotional sensitivity. First, a professional team conducts an assessment to determine the severity of the hoarding situation. Next, they develop a cleanup plan that includes s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, recycle, and discard. After decluttering, the team deep cleans and sanitizes the area, removing biohazards, mold, and pests if necessary. The final step often involves organizing the remaining items to create a functional living space. Many services also offer follow-up support to help individuals maintain a clean and safe environment.

  • Can air quality testing help prevent building damage?

    Air quality testing can indirectly help prevent building damage by identifying issues such as high humidity levels, mold growth, or chemical fumes that may harm structural integrity over time. For instance, mold can weaken building materials, while excessive moisture can lead to wood rot or corrosion. Testing for pollutants and environmental conditions provides crucial data to address these problems before they escalate. Implementing measures like dehumidifiers, improved insulation, or mold remediation not only preserves air quality but also protects the buildings longevity. In commercial properties, addressing these issues proactively can save significant costs associated with repairs and ensure a safer and more durable structure.
